Product Description
GE IC694CHS392
Overview
The GE IC694CHS392 is a high-speed counter module designed for the GE Fanuc Series 90-30 PLC system. It delivers fast and accurate counting capabilities for applications requiring precise measurement, pulse processing, and motion control. This module is ideal for industrial automation environments where high-speed input processing and real-time response are essential.

Product Parameters
The IC694CHS392 is engineered to support multiple high-speed inputs and counting modes. It is compatible with the Series 90-30 PLC platform and requires a compatible rack and power supply to operate. The module supports a range of input frequencies, typically reaching several kHz depending on the wiring and signal source. It also offers flexible configuration options for different counting needs, such as up/down counting, quadrature decoding, and event counting.

Core Features
-
High-Speed Counting: Designed for rapid pulse input processing, ensuring accurate counts even at high frequencies.
-
Quadrature Encoder Support: Enables precise position tracking and motion control in automated systems.
-
Multiple Counting Modes: Supports up/down counting, pulse accumulation, and event-based counting.
-
Stable Performance: Reliable operation in harsh industrial conditions with minimal signal distortion.
-
Easy Integration: Seamlessly integrates into existing Series 90-30 PLC systems without major configuration changes.

Structure & Components
The IC694CHS392 module includes the following key components:
-
Input Terminal Block: Provides connection points for high-speed pulse sources such as encoders, proximity sensors, or flow meters.
-
Signal Conditioning Circuitry: Filters and stabilizes input signals to reduce noise and improve counting accuracy.
-
Processing Core: High-speed counting processor to handle rapid pulse inputs and execute counting algorithms.
-
Configuration Interface: Allows setup of counting mode, input type, and scaling parameters through PLC programming software.
-
Status Indicators: LED indicators display module operation status, input activity, and error conditions.

Installation & Maintenance
Installation Tips
-
Install the module into a compatible Series 90-30 rack with correct slot alignment.
-
Use shielded cables for encoder and pulse signal connections to minimize interference.
-
Ensure proper grounding to prevent noise affecting counting accuracy.
-
Confirm the module’s input voltage levels match the connected sensors.
Maintenance Advice
-
Regularly inspect wiring for wear or loose connections.
-
Keep the module and rack clean from dust and debris.
-
Check LED indicators for abnormal signals or error states.
-
Update PLC configuration and calibration if counting behavior changes over time.
